Autumn Pumpkin Bake

This is a great recipe for chilly fall nights. I also make it for Halloween night, and my kids even eat the vegetables when I prepare this, as they love pumpkin. This recipe came from a school cookbook. Show more

Ready In: 3 hrs 30 mins

Serves: 6

Directions

  1. Wash pumpkin, cut off top and scrape out seeds and stringy portion and discard.
  2. Cook ground beef slightly and drain off fat.
  3. Add onion and garlic and saute lightly.
  4. Add seasonings and tomato juice.
  5. Heat through.
  6. Mix with uncooked rice.
  7. Layer 1/3 each of the cabbage, potatoes, rice and meat mixture in pumpkin.
  8. Repeat layers and replace lid.
  9. Bake at 350' for 2 1/2 to 3 hours or until done.
  10. Pumpkin is done when it is soft when pierced with a fork.
